DTC C2141/41: Transmitter ID1 Error; DTC C2142/42: Transmitter ID2 Error; DTC C2143/43: Transmitter ID3 Error; DTC C2144/44: Transmitter ID4 Error: Procedure

  1. IDENTIFY TRANSMITTER CORRESPONDING TO DTC 
    1. Set all tire pressures to the specified value(s). Refer to PRECAUTION .
    2. Turn the ignition switch off.
    3. Connect the Techstream to the DLC3.
    4. Turn the ignition switch to ON.
    5. Turn the Techstream on.
    6. Enter the following menus: Chassis / Tire Pressure Monitor / Data List.
    7. Display the "ID Tire Inflation Pressure" data for each wheel using the Techstream.
    8. Rapidly reduce the tire pressure for each wheel at least 40 kPa (0.4 kg/cm2 , 5.8 psi) within 30 seconds. If "ID Tire Inflation Pressure" displayed on the Techstream (ID1 to ID4) does not change, the tire pressure warning valve and transmitter corresponding to the unchanged "ID Tire Inflation Pressure" data was the cause of the output DTC.

      HINT: 

      • Identify the malfunctioning tire pressure warning valve and transmitter by repeatedly decreasing the tire pressure for each tire.
      • Record which "ID Tire Inflation Pressure" data (ID1 to ID4) corresponds to each tire.

      HINT: 

      *: It may take about 2 or 3 minutes until the values are displayed. If the values are not displayed after a few minutes, perform troubleshooting according to the inspection procedure for DTCs C2121/21 to C2124/24. Refer to DTC C2121/21: No Signal from Transmitter ID1; DTC C2122/22: No Signal from Transmitter ID2; DTC C2123/23: No Signal from Transmitter ID3; DTC C2124/24: No Signal from Transmitter ID4; DTC C2181/81: Transmitter ID1 not Received (Test Mode DTC); DTC C2182/82: Transmitter ID2 not Received (Test Mode DTC); DTC C2183/83: Transmitter ID3 not Received (Test Mode DTC); DTC C2184/84: Transmitter ID4 not Received (Test Mode DTC) .

    9. Check the Data List.

      Result

      Result Detection Condition
      One of "ID Tire Inflation Pressure" data (ID1 to ID4) changed. Normal
      "ID Tire Inflation Pressure" data did not change. Transmitter corresponding to DTC
      NOTE:
      • If no "ID Tire Inflation Pressure" data has changed, reset the tire pressure to the appropriate specified value and rotate the tire 90 to 270 degrees. Then, rapidly release the tire pressure and recheck it.
      • Record the transmitter IDs and positions of transmitters that are normal.
    10. When the "ID Tire inflation Pressure" data (ID1 to ID4) has changed, repeat this procedure to identify the tire pressure warning valve and transmitter that corresponds to the DTC.
    11. When all of the "ID Tire Inflation Pressure" data (ID1 to ID4) have changed, identify the malfunctioning tire pressure warning valve and transmitter using the recorded ID numbers and output DTCs.

    NEXT: Go to next step 

  2. REPLACE TIRE PRESSURE WARNING VALVE AND TRANSMITTER 
    1. Replace the identified tire pressure warning valve and transmitter with a new one. Refer to REMOVAL .

      HINT: 

      • Before installing a new tire pressure warning valve and transmitter, write down its transmitter ID.
      • The IDs for the tire pressure warning valve and transmitters which are not being replaced should be checked using the Techstream and recorded.

    NEXT: Go to next step 

  3. REGISTRATION OF TRANSMITTER ID 
    1. Register the transmitter ID for all wheels. Refer to REGISTRATION .

    NEXT: Go to next step 

  4. PERFORM INITIALIZATION 
    1. Perform initialization. Refer to INITIALIZATION .

    NEXT: Go to next step

      HINT: 

      • *: It may take about 2 or 3 minutes until the values are displayed.
      • If no "ID Tire Inflation Pressure" data has changed, reset the tire pressure to the appropriate specified value and rotate the tire 90 to 270 degrees. Then, rapidly release the tire pressure and recheck it.

      Result

      Result Proceed to
      Tire pressure values are not displayed. A
      All tire pressure readings are equal to specified values. B

    B → END 

    A → See step   6 

  6. REPLACE TIRE PRESSURE WARNING ECU. Refer to  REMOVAL
